Hai Yen is one of the communes assessed to have done well in poverty reduction in Cao Loc district. By the end of 2024, the whole commune will have only 4 poor households (accounting for 0.82%), the lowest among 22 communes and towns in the district.
Mr. Luong Van Mao, Chairman of Hai Yen Commune People's Committee, said: In order to effectively implement the national target program on sustainable poverty reduction, every year, the Commune Party Committee issues a specialized resolution on poverty reduction; the Commune People's Committee issues a plan to organize implementation, develop a plan to support poor households; and effectively implement social security work to ensure full, timely and appropriate beneficiaries. From 2022 to present, from State capital sources, the commune government has integrated the implementation of 6 projects to support about 150 households with fertilizers, seedlings, techniques for caring for Bao Lam persimmon trees, star anise trees and planting macadamia trees... Currently, in the commune, there are no more policy households or meritorious people's families that are poor households. With those efforts, in April 2025, Hai Yen commune was honored to receive a certificate of merit from the Chairman of the Provincial People's Committee for its outstanding achievements in the emulation movement "For the poor - No one is left behind" in the period 2021-2025.
Like Hai Yen commune, in recent times, Thach Dan commune has actively implemented projects to support people in developing production. From 2022 to present, the People's Committee of the commune has supported 5 projects with the participation of nearly 100 poor, near-poor and newly escaped-poverty households. The projects focus on supporting people with breeding animals such as chickens, buffaloes, cows and seedlings, fertilizers for anise care. Thereby contributing to increasing income and reducing poverty in the area. By the end of 2024, the rate of poor households in the whole commune will be 4.8%, down 22.4% compared to 2019.
According to Decision No. 2279/QD-UBND dated December 20, 2024 of the Provincial People's Committee Chairman on approving the results of reviewing poor and near-poor households in 2024 in Lang Son province, Cao Loc is one of the two districts with the lowest poverty rate (2.26%). |
Mr. Nguyen Van Vuong, Ban Rooc village, Thach Dan commune said: My family has 2,000 star anise trees, but in the past, due to lack of experience and not knowing how to apply scientific and technological advances in production, the productivity was low. In 2023, the family was supported with over 850 kg of organic fertilizer to care for star anise, and at the same time participated in training courses on applying scientific and technological advances in production. Thanks to regular care and fertilization, the star anise forest has grown well. In 2024, the family harvested nearly 3 tons of star anise, bringing in an income of nearly 100 million VND. The family has now escaped poverty.
According to statistics, from 2022 to present, Cao Loc District People's Committee has implemented 50 projects to support community production development and 6 projects to develop production according to value chains for over 1,000 poor households, near-poor households, and newly escaped poverty households with a total budget of more than 30 billion VND from the state budget. Households are supported with plants, breeds, fertilizers and cultivation and livestock techniques: commercial buffaloes and cows; pig farming; models of planting and caring for chestnut trees, macadamia trees, black canarium trees; models of planting and caring for Bao Lam persimmons; organic care of star anise...
Production development support models have been deployed in communes and villages with special difficulties, with the active participation of the people, bringing practical results, promoting the growth and socio-economic development of the district. The implementation of support projects has contributed to creating jobs, increasing income from 10 to 60 million VND/year for each poor household, thereby contributing to reducing the poverty rate in the district. In 2023, the total number of poor households in the district was 1,082, accounting for 5.27%. In 2024, the whole district will have 465 poor households, accounting for 2.26% (a decrease of 3.01%, equivalent to a decrease of 617 households compared to 2023), achieving the target set by the District Party Committee (a decrease of 3% or more/year). The district's average income per capita in 2024 will reach 43.33 million VND/person, an increase of 4.64 million VND compared to 2023.
Mr. Dong Minh Quy, Deputy Head of the Department of Agriculture and Environment of Cao Loc district, said: To achieve the above results, in recent years, the department has focused on advising the district People's Committee to direct the People's Committees of communes and towns to fully and promptly implement programs, projects and policies to support poor households and people of ethnic minorities in the area. In the coming time, the department will continue to advise the district People's Committee to effectively implement poverty reduction policies; organize the assessment of the results of the review of poor households and near-poor households to ensure quality, accurately reflecting the local situation; have appropriate support solutions to the needs of poor households and near-poor households, contributing to increasing the effectiveness of support policies. In addition, the department has increased propaganda about the Party and State's poverty reduction policies and guidelines to the people, thereby arousing and promoting the spirit of effort and self-reliance to escape poverty of the people.
By implementing synchronous poverty reduction solutions, focusing on allocating and integrating capital sources to support people in developing production, this is the "leverage" to help poor households rise up. From there, people will have more income, sustainably reduce poverty, and build new rural areas.
